Route 65: THE REBUILD The Final Phase - Springfield

Update for Week of September 4-11
  • TRAFFIC ALERT: Northbound Route 65 CLOSED between Route 60 and Sunshine Street starting at 12:01 a.m. on Friday, Sept. 6, until Friday, Sept. 20, at the latest. (Contractor expects to open northbound Route 65 by Sept. 14 or Sept.15.)
  • Ramps to northbound Route 65 at the Route 60 interchange closed                                           

Work Scheduled:  

  • Remove old northbound Route 65 pavement between Route 60 and Sunshine Street
  • Grade base rock and prepare for new concrete pavement
  • Pour concrete for new northbound Route 65 pavement
  • ADDITIONAL INFORMATION: All new concrete pavement will be smoothed using a diamond-grinding process at the end of the project in mid-to-late September 

Traffic Impacts:  

  • Northbound Route 65 CLOSED between Route 60 and Sunshine Street starting at 12:01 a.m. Friday, September 6
    • Eastbound Route 60-to-northbound Route 65 ramp closed
    • Westbound Route 60-to-northbound Route 65 ramp closed
    • Route 60 median crossovers closed between Route 65 and Greene County Route NN/J interchange east of Springfield
    • Northbound right-lane of Glenstone Avenue closed on bridge over Route 60 to allow for “free” rights from westbound Route 60-to-northbound Glenstone Avenue ramp
    • Westbound Route 60 off ramp at Glenstone Avenue could be closed at times if traffic congestion occurs
  • Night Work: Northbound lanes closed in areas between Sunshine Street and Route 60. At least one lane open. Work hours: 8 p.m. to 6 a.m. Wednesday-Thursday, September 4-5.
  • Temporary traffic signals in operation at Blackman Road/Battlefield Road and Greene County Route D/Route 125 intersections
  • Signed detours:
    • West detour: I-44 to eastbound Missouri Route 360 to eastbound U.S. Route 60 to southbound Route 65
    • East detour: I-44 to Missouri Route 125 to westbound U.S. 60 to southbound Route 65

Project Summary: 

  • Sunday-Thursday, August 4-8 -- COMPLETE
    • All southbound lanes of Route 65 CLOSED between Sunshine Street and Battlefield Road
    • Southbound on ramp from Sunshine Street to Route 65 CLOSED
    • Southbound off ramp from Route 65 to Battlefield Road CLOSED 
  • Thursday-Friday, August 8-16 -- COMPLETE
    • All southbound lanes of Route 65 CLOSED between Battlefield Road and Route 60
    • Southbound Route 65 OPEN between Sunshine Street and Battlefield Road, but reduced to one lane
    • Southbound on ramp from Battlefield Road to Route 65 CLOSED
    • Southbound Route 65-to-westbound Route 60 ramp CLOSED 

All lanes of Route 65 open during the Labor Day holiday (Friday-Friday, August 16-September 6) 

  • Friday-Friday, September 6-20 (All northbound Route 65 lanes could be open as early as Saturday or Sunday, Sept. 14 or 15)
    • All northbound lanes of Route 65 CLOSED between Route 60 and Sunshine Street
    • Eastbound Route 60-to-northbound Route 65 ramp CLOSED
    • Westbound Route 60-to-northbound Route 65 ramp CLOSED
    • Northbound off ramp from Route 65 to Battlefield Road CLOSED
    • Northbound on ramp from Battlefield Road to northbound Route 65 CLOSED
    • Northbound off ramp from Route 65 to Sunshine Street CLOSED
    • One northbound lane of Glenstone Avenue at bridge over Route 60 closed to allow “free” rights from westbound Route 60-to-northbound Glenstone Avenue
    • Route 60 crossovers CLOSED between Route 65 and Greene County Routes NN/J 
  • September 15-November 1
    • Nighttime lane closings for shoulder construction/guardrail/striping/pavement smoothing 
  • Prime Contractor: Emery Sapp and Sons, Inc. of Columbia
  • Completion Date: November 2019 (However, contractor plans to complete project by late September.)
  • Total Project Cost: $8.1 million
